コード例 #1
0
        public void filtrarDataGrid()
        {
            Logica.Users consulta  = new Logica.Users();
            DataSet      resultado = consulta.FiltrarUsuarios(textBox1.Text);

            DataTable DatosTabla = new DataTable();

            DatosTabla = resultado.Tables[0];

            dtgListado.DataSource = DatosTabla;
        }
コード例 #2
0
        public void cargarDataGrid()
        {
            Logica.Users consulta  = new Logica.Users();
            DataSet      resultado = consulta.ListadoUsuarios();

            DataTable DatosTabla = new DataTable();

            DatosTabla = resultado.Tables[0];

            dtgListado.DataSource = DatosTabla;
        }
コード例 #3
0
        public void ComboUsers()
        {
            Logica.Users consulta  = new Logica.Users();
            DataSet      resultado = consulta.ListadoUsuarios();

            DataTable DatosCombo = new DataTable();

            DatosCombo = resultado.Tables[0];

            cmbUsers.DisplayMember = "nick";
            cmbUsers.ValueMember   = "id";
            cmbUsers.DataSource    = DatosCombo;
        }
コード例 #4
0
        private void btnConsultar_Click(object sender, EventArgs e)
        {
            if (validarConsulta())
            {
                Logica.Users obj       = new Logica.Users();            // creo un objeto de la clase users
                DataSet      resultado = obj.consultar(txtId.Text);     // utilizo el metodo consultar y guardo el resultado
                DataTable    miTabla   = new DataTable();               // defino mi datatable para leer datos
                miTabla = resultado.Tables[0];                          //lleno mi datatable con el resultado de la consulta

                txtNick.Text      = miTabla.Rows[0]["nick"].ToString(); //busco la fila cero y la columna nick
                txtPassword.Text  = miTabla.Rows[0]["password"].ToString();
                txtCPassword.Text = miTabla.Rows[0]["password"].ToString();
            }
            else
            {
                MessageBox.Show("Ingresa el id para consultar");
            }
        } // cierre metodo consultar click
コード例 #5
0
 private void btnEliminar_Click(object sender, EventArgs e)
 {
     if (validarEliminar())
     {// true
         //registramos
         Logica.Users obj       = new Logica.Users();
         bool         respuesta = obj.EliminarUsuario(txtId.Text);
         if (respuesta == true)
         {
             MessageBox.Show("Se ha eliminado con éxito");
             Limpiar();
             cargarDataGrid();
         }
         else
         {
             MessageBox.Show("No se ha encontrado el usuario con ID " + txtId.Text);
         }
     }
     else
     {
         MessageBox.Show("Verifica los datos a registrar");
     }
 }
コード例 #6
0
        } // cierre metodo consultar click

        private void btnCrear_Click(object sender, EventArgs e)
        {
            if (validarRegistro())
            {// true
                //registramos
                Logica.Users obj       = new Logica.Users();
                bool         respuesta = obj.CrearUsuario(txtNick.Text, txtPassword.Text);
                if (respuesta == true)
                {
                    MessageBox.Show("Se han registrado los Datos");
                    Limpiar();
                    cargarDataGrid();
                }
                else
                {
                    MessageBox.Show("Ha ocurrido un error");
                }
            }
            else
            {
                MessageBox.Show("Verifica los datos a registrar");
            }
        }